ONE NEW COVID CASE IN ALLEGANY COUNTY

Allegany County reports only one new COVID-19 case since last Thursday and no additional deaths. The county’s positivity rate is 1.77 per cent, while the state as a whole, is reporting 1.18 per cent. The Health Department is holding two walk-in COVID-19 vaccination clinics at the Willowbrook Office Complex, both on Wednesday. From 9 a.m. to noon, both the Moderna and Johnson and Johnson vaccines will be administered; then, from 1 to 4 p.m., the Pfizer COVID vaccine will be administered. Just over 40 per cent of Allegany County residents have been fully vaccinated, compared to 57.7 per cent of all Maryland residents. An added note: there will be no COVID testing this week at the Allegany County Fairgrounds because of the fair; testing will resume there on Monday, July 26th, from 2 to 7 p.m.
